“The Lord graciously remembered and visited Sarah as He had said, and the Lord did for her as He had promised. So Sarah conceived and gave birth to a son for Abraham in his old age, at the appointed time of which God had spoken to him. Abraham named his son Isaac (laughter), the son to whom Sarah gave birth. “ – Genesis 21:1-3 (AMP)
Several miracles happen, not really because the recipients fulfilled with precision their own part to play in the process, but because God is always faithful to His Word and He honours His covenant to His people. The Lord God promised Abraham that Sarah would be the one to bear his child and not another woman. What this means is that even if a hundred women give birth to children for Abraham, if none comes from Sarah, then God’s Word has not yet been fulfilled.
Miracles don’t answer to human logic, they answer to the word of God and His faithfulness. Sarah was definitely older than Hagar, her maid but God insisted that Sarah would conceive despite the fact that they’ve looked for an alternative to have the result they desired. God ensures that His Word comes to pass ultimately to prove and establish His faithfulness, and many times not necessarily because you really waited with all your heart or was convinced the promise would be fulfilled.
Praise God! Sarah conceived and gave birth to Isaac.
